WE'RE ALL ADULTS HERE. Act like an adult. Stay away from OOC drama. However, if you do find that you're having an issue with another player's actions, don't hesitate to contact one or both of the moderators so that the situation can be handled in a mature way.
KNOW YOUR CHARACTER. Players need to be sure they have a firm idea of their character's personality and the game's premise before applying. While characters are expected to grow and change over time, the spirit of your character should remain the same. In simple terms, the character you apply with is the character we expect you to play with. Needless to say, then Mary Sues/Gary Stus are also not allowed.
QUALITY > SPEED/QUANTITY. Both spelling and grammar are important. If you use Firefox, there should be an online spellchecker already installed on your browser. With this, your browser will point out misspelled words as you type à la Microsoft Word. This should successfully prevent a majority of spelling issues, though we do understand that typos happen.
In addition: we understand that some characters may not have the best of spelling. In-Character writing traits are fine! They should be clear in the examples provided with your application though.
HOW MANY CHARACTERS CAN YOU PLAY? Players are currently only allowed four (4) characters. If a player has reached the limit and wishes to take on more characters, we will make a call on a case by case basis. Players must have maintained high activity levels with all four of their previous characters. If a player takes on additional characters and proves to be incapable of handling the character load, they may be asked to release their characters back for application. Players cannot play two characters that would interact regularly (i.e. - the same player cannot play Ron and Harry).
LET'S BE ACTIVE! Players are expected to post at least 1 journal entry (more than a sentence or two would be preferred, but as long as it generates interaction, it will pass) and/or a completed log every two weeks. Players who fail to meet activity requirements regularly will be removed from the game. We're not strict but we do think activity is important to a successful game. We as mods will be doing our best to provide characters with events to be involved in and/or react to, and we encourage that players explore plots on their own (more on this below).
That said, hiatuses are allowed. While we're not going to set a limit, please be reasonable. Communicating your need to be away and for exactly how long is important. Don't abuse this!

COMMUNICATE. Given the nature of this game, dark plots will happen. We only ask that our members research and put some thought into it when taking part in them, and that you contact us if you are planning character death or medical situations that are not part of game-wide plot.
Still on the nature of this game being as it is, we recognise that some characters who were not specifically mentioned as dead in the book are listed as dead in this game. This is not negotiable. Fifty or so people died on the side of the Order and the DA that day, and it'd be incredibly unrealistic if only the people specifically mentioned (as it only adds up to about 5) were those killed.
Also, in case it needs to be said, please avoid godmodding at all costs. It's not allowed, and occasionally it tends to be offensive. Let the player know, or ask for permission before offering up someone else's character for something they just might not be okay with.
WHAT WE REALLY WON'T TOLERATE. Plagiarism of any variety is not allowed. If we receive a report that you have stolen anything from another writer without credit or permission, and the explanation for it is not satisfactory, you will be removed. There is a zero tolerance policy for this.
FOR IN-GAME KNOWLEDGE. As far as your character knows,journals that allow you to speak to others, with the ability to ward them, have always been in existence. Whether your character has always had one or is just acquiring one is up to you.
Journals wards should be clearly labeled so that people know exactly who can and cannot read them. Strike-outs cannot be read.
Thread headings should be formatted as follows:
Characters: [Who's involved this scene.] Setting: [Where and when (morning, evening, between what events of the day) the scene is occurring.] Ratings: [For simplicity's sake, use the movie rating system. We allow threads of all ratings. Add warnings as necessary.] Summary: [A short summary of the scene. Maybe what it's trying to achieve, what spawned it into being, and etc.]
